cadastrar em duas bases de dados

Gostaria de cadastra em uma tabela em banco e utilizar um insert para cadastrar esses mesmo dados em outra tabela de outro banco, isso é possivel utilizando o scriptcase.

Att Arquimedes

Basta criar uma segunda conexão para o banco adicional e usar essa conexão na macro sc_exec_sql.

Haroldo obrigado pela dica, resolveu um problema e apareceu outro.
Ele esta cadastrando normalmente no local e esta enviando tb para o outro banco na web.
Porem quando da algum problema na internet, nao é mais possivel cadastrar no banco local, pois apesa da utilização do segunda base de dados ser utilizada somente apos o cadastro da base local, quando não tem conexão de internet não é possivel cadastrar no local.
Aparece a seguinte mensagem
“Erro ao estabelecer uma conexão com o banco de dados:”
So que a conexão local esta normal e nada mais do formulario aparece depois dessa mensagem como se a conexao local tambem estivesse com problema.

Help

O outro banco pelo que percebo é “Localhost”. E seu sistema deve esta na WEB. Se estiver na WEB e sua conexão cair não tem como ele dar insert em sua aplicação em localhost ou vice versa, se ele estiver em local host e a internet cair, ele não vai dar insert no banco alocado na web. Acredito que o que estais tentando fazer é uma tabela temporária “localmente” para quando a net cair ele gravar as informações e quando a net voltar ele atualizar o banco web. É isso o que pretendes?

Não caro amigo, eu conseguir utilizando a dica do Haroldo, o sistema esta local com banco local, e com uma tabela na web, quando ele cadastra local esta enviando para web perfeitamente, o problema é quando a net cai nao consegue cadastra nem local pois informa que a “Erro ao estabelecer uma conexão com o banco de dados:”, porem é so para esse formulario com essa conexao web.
Vou tenta a dica que voce deu sobre a tabela temporaria para envia para web quando a internet volta.

Att Arquimedes

Bom dia amigo, qual é o banco de dados que vc está utilizando???

então, ideal é ter uma app background rodando a cada tempos e pegando dados da tabela temporária e descarregando na web

Será que não seria porque a conexão principal do form estaria na conexão WEB?
Tente colocar a conexão padrão para a Local e sempre antes de inserir verifique se a conexão WEB está funcionando, se estiver mude para ela com a marco.

Se não tive conexão com a internet vai dar o erro mesmo, inclusive terá que desabilitar erros de sql na aplicação.

Outra opção, talvez muitos não concordem mais eu concordo em usar códigos não nativos do SC para resolver problemas. Oque torna o SC bom é isso o uso de outras bibliotecas em seus projetos.

Não teria como você deixar nesse formulário apenas a conexão local, quando fosse inserir verificar se tem a conexão com o banco da internet, se tiver, use a CLASSE nativa do PHP, o PDO, faça esse statment de INSERT manual, como é em apenas um formulário vai resolver seu problema.

Oque acha?